What happened

According to the US weather agency NOAA, solar storms are forecast for the weekend that could produce vivid auroras, or northern lights, across North America and Canada.

Why it matters

In the United States, the weather monitoring agency has announced that the northern lights could be visible in the northern United States and Canada, as strong geomagnetic storms are expected.

Common ground

These could also light up the skies over Germany, especially in the north and along the coasts, during the night of 5 to 6 June.
